Potential and Kinetic Energy Lesson Plan: Coaster Creator Game
In this lesson plan, which is adaptable for grades 6-12, students use an online simulation to design their own roller coaster car and track which uses just the right amount of energy to get a coaster going but make sure it stops in time. Students will observe real-time transfers of energy between kinetic, potential, and dissipated energy. Alternative Energy Sources Lesson Plan: Fossil Fuels’ Impact on the Environment
In this lesson plan for grades 6 through 12, students will use BrainPOP resources to learn how alternative sources of energy can be created and utilized. They’ll explore the impact of fossil fuels and alternative energy on our society and environment, and create an informational brochure to share important information about alternative energy.
